No. 3 Softball Splits Opening Day of Bearcat Round Robin

Box Score 1 | Box Score 2 GREENWOOD, S.C. - The No. 3 University of North Georgia softball team split its two games on the opening day of the Bearcat Round Robin Saturday.

GAME 1 - USCB 3, UNG 1
It was all quiet on the scoreboard until USC Beaufort struck for three in the top of the fourth, scoring on a leadoff walk, an error that scored two and a homer to right. North Georgia got one back in the bottom of the inning off a Madison Simmons homer, but that was all UNG could get as the Sandsharks got the win.

Tybee Denton (5-1) was saddled with the loss, fanning 10 over the complete seven innings.

GAME 2 - UNG 15, CU 7 (6 inn.)
North Georgia got on the board first in the second game of the day, starting with a run in the second on a Chowan error. UNG scored two more in the third off a Haley Cummings RBI double and another Hawk error, putting the Nighthawks up, 3-0.

The Nighthawks went off in the fourth, plating nine runs in the inning, highlighted by a Jolie Lester RBI double and a Cummings grand slam. After Chowan battled back in the fifth to cut the lead to 12-7, North Georgia plated three runs off another Cummings hit, this time an RBI double that ended the game.

Delaney Heaberlin (4-1) earned the win, pitching a total of 5.2 innings and allowing just one run.

NOTES
- Cummings finished game two going 3-for-5 with seven RBI.
